What is the first step to writing an equation in slope-intercept form using the given points: (-3, 1), (-4, -2)?


What is the rate of change?

A) Find the slope using the slope formula y = mx + b; m = -3

B) Find the slope using the slope formula

y2 - y1

x2 - x1

; m = 3

C) Find the slope using the slope formula

y2 - y1

x2 - x1

; m = -3

D) Find the slope using the slope formula y = mx + b; m = 3

Slope is expressed as

Slope, m= change in value of y on the vertical axis / change in value of x on the horizontal axis.

change in the value of y = y2 - y1

Change in value of x = x2 -x1

Looking at the given points, (-3, 1), (-4, -2)

y2 = final value of y = - 2

y 1 = initial value of y = 1

x2 = final value of x = - 4

x1 = initial value of x = - 3

Slope = (- 2 - 1)/(- 4 - - 3)

Slope = - 3/- 1 = 3

Therefore, the first step to writing an equation in slope-intercept form using the given points: (-3, 1), (-4, -2) is

B) Find the slope using the slope formula

y2 - y1

x2 - x1

m = 3
